Pair Trading with Chevron Corp and Columbia Research
The main advantage of trading using opposite Chevron Corp and Columbia Research positions is that it hedges away some unsystematic risk. Because of two separate transactions, even if Chevron Corp position performs unexpectedly, Columbia Research can make up some of the losses. Pair trading also minimizes risk from directional movements in the market.
